Abstract

The utility model discloses a V-shaped grid cultivation device for pomegranate, which comprises a plurality of V-shaped support rods; every two V-shaped supporting rods are arranged into a group, the two V-shaped supporting rods are arranged side by side, a space is reserved between the two V-shaped supporting rods, and the two V-shaped supporting rods are connected into a whole through a steel pipe at the upper end position of the V-shaped supporting rods; each group of V-shaped supporting rods are uniformly arranged backwards at intervals, and the bottom positions of the V-shaped supporting rods on the same side are positioned on the same straight line; and the V-shaped supporting rods at the front and rear sides are also provided with rope holes; the rope holes are uniformly arranged on the rod body at intervals, and steel wire ropes are further connected in series in the rope holes. The pomegranate tree can enhance light transmittance, improve photosynthetic intensity and ventilation, and the pomegranate tree grows to bloom and bear fruits in a certain period, so that the germination capacity and the fruit bearing rate are improved, the damage of fruit burning, poor coloring, fruit surface yellowing, fruit swelling and the like caused by overhigh temperature is reduced, the pomegranate tree can be picked conveniently, the time and the labor are saved, and the labor cost is reduced.

Background
Pomegranate is an ancient fruit tree species, has a long cultivation history and rich germplasm resources, and is an important economic forest. The fruits are rich in a large amount of phytochemicals, have medical effects of resisting oxidation, cancer, bacteria, infection, diabetes, cardiovascular diseases and the like, have high clinical medical and health-care values, and are praised as super fruits.
The pomegranate cultivation generally needs a support, so that the pomegranate can grow vertically, and can ensure illumination, ventilation and the like, if the pomegranate grows in a radioactive mode, the pomegranate tree is easily disordered in structure, insufficient in illumination and closed in the canopy, and the normal growth and fruiting of the tree are affected. At present, the support of the pomegranate tree is inconvenient to pick, poor in ventilation and poor in stability, cannot achieve the effect of shading and shading fruits, causes the damages of fruit burning, poor coloring, fruit surface yellowing, fruit swelling and the like due to overhigh temperature, is not beneficial to the growth of the pomegranate tree, and further influences the quality of the fruits. Detailed Description
The present invention will be further clarified by the following embodiments with reference to the attached drawings, which are implemented on the premise of the technical solution of the present invention, and it should be understood that these embodiments are only used for illustrating the present invention and are not used for limiting the scope of the present invention.
As shown in fig. 1 and 2, a V-shaped trellis cultivation device for pomegranate comprises a plurality of V-shaped support rods 1; every two V-shaped supporting rods 1 are arranged into a group, the two V-shaped supporting rods 1 are arranged side by side, a space is reserved between the two V-shaped supporting rods 1, and the two V-shaped supporting rods 1 are connected into a whole at the upper end positions of the two V-shaped supporting rods through steel pipes 2; each group of V-shaped supporting rods 1 are uniformly arranged backwards at intervals, and the bottom positions of the V-shaped supporting rods 1 on the same side are positioned on the same straight line; and the V-shaped support rod 1 at the front and rear side positions is also provided with a rope hole 3; the rope holes 3 are uniformly arranged on the rod body at intervals, steel wire ropes 4 are also connected in the rope holes 3 in series, and fixing bases 5 are also arranged at the outer side positions of the V-shaped support rods 1 at the front side and the rear side; the fixing bases 5 on the front side and the rear side are respectively provided with two fixing bases, the positions of the two fixing bases correspond to the bottom positions of the two V-shaped supporting rods 1, and the steel wire ropes 4 penetrate through the rope holes 3 in the V-shaped supporting rods 1 and then are respectively and correspondingly fixed on the fixing bases 5.
A connecting rod 6 is also arranged at the middle position of the V-shaped supporting rod 1; and the height of the V-shaped supporting rod 1 is set to be 3 m; the distance between the lower end parts of two V-shaped support rods 1 in the same group is set to be 2.2 m; the distance between two adjacent groups of V-shaped support rods 1 is set to be 10 m; the rope holes 3 on the V-shaped support rod 1 are uniformly arranged at intervals; and the height difference between the adjacent cord holes 3 is set to 50cm, and at least five are provided.
The steel pipe 2 is correspondingly set to be a 304 steel pipe; the upper ends of the V-shaped support rods 1 at two sides are detachably fixed in a screw mounting mode; the fixed base 5 can be correspondingly set into a deep-buried type timber pile structure; the V-shaped support rod 1 is vertically arranged and can be correspondingly buried in soil.
When the cultivation device of the device is used, the pomegranate tree is cultivated to the position of the V-shaped support rod, the main trunk of the pomegranate tree is fixed on the V-shaped support rod through tools such as a rubber rope and the like, in the process of cultivating and growing the pomegranate trees, the trunk grows upwards in an inclined way along the direction of the V-shaped supporting rod, branches of the pomegranate trees are bound on the steel wire rope according to the growing condition, the branches grow outwards along the direction of the steel wire rope, the set pomegranate tree growth mode is equivalent to that the pomegranate tree grows transversely to the outside rather than singly grows upwards, the light transmittance can be enhanced, the photosynthetic intensity is improved, the ventilation performance is also enhanced, the pomegranate tree grows to blossom and fruit in a certain period, the sprouting capacity and the fruit bearing rate are improved, the damage of fruit burning, poor coloring, fruit surface yellowing, fruit swelling and the like caused by overhigh temperature is reduced, the picking is convenient, the time and the labor are saved, and the labor cost is reduced.
In the device, the distance of 2.2m is arranged between two V-shaped support rods in the same group, and the height is correspondingly set to be 3m, so that mechanical equipment and workers can conveniently enter the device, and the subsequent picking, pesticide spraying and other work are facilitated; the upper ends of the rods are connected into a whole through steel pipes, and the connecting rods are arranged to enable the whole structure to be more stable; and the wire rope of this device passes the rope hole on the pole after-fixing on the unable adjustment base of both sides, and the position sets up rationally, and wire rope becomes the straight line and arranges, strengthens the firm and overall structure's of V type bracing piece stability.
